(4th edition)? > I don't intend to make any changes to the version of the fileserver code you should have now, and it doesn't have any IDE support. The 9P2000 fileserver, which I am again working on now that update is out of the way, is planned to support any device the cpu/terminal kernel has. Of course, by the time I'm finished all this may be moot as there is another (separate) fileserver project underway which may subsume the Plan 9 one.
